arm: make the assembler functions compatible with non ELF/gas platforms

Allow assembling arm neon functions for IOS and arm windows.

#ifdef __APPLE__
# define EXTERN_ASM _
#else
# define EXTERN_ASM
#endif
#if defined(__APPLE__) || defined(_WIN32)
# define HAVE_AS_ARCH_DIRECTIVE 0
# define HAVE_AS_FPU_DIRECTIVE 0
#else
# define HAVE_AS_ARCH_DIRECTIVE 1
# define HAVE_AS_FPU_DIRECTIVE 1
#endif
.macro function name
.globl EXTERN_ASM\name
#ifdef __ELF__
.type EXTERN_ASM\name, %function
#endif
EXTERN_ASM\name:
.endm
